  • Patent number: 4521127
    Abstract: The invention contemplates sealed lead-screw propulsion mechanism for the piston of a container for stick deodorant or the like substance, wherein the container must be filled by hot melted substance which becomes the stick after it has been allowed to cool. The seal is operative when the piston is in its lower-most position within the container, so that liquid (melted) substance cannot seep through the region of lead-screw engagement to the piston. Once the substance has solidified, there is no further need for the seal, beyond retention of aromatic ingredients, i.e., until the product has reached the ultimate consumer; and the seal is operable only upon first dispensing use of the container.

  • Patent number: 4433790
    Abstract: The invention contemplates a container closure, with a frangible cover preassembled thereto, such that both the closure and the cover have independent snap-lock engagement to the container-neck finish, in a single axially displaced assembly of both of the preassembled parts to the neck finish. The cover must be broken to gain access to container contents, so that any breakage provides a direct warning as to possible tampering. In the disclosed embodiment, the closure which remains after destruction and removal of the cover, has child-safety features, in respect of its snap-action engagement to the neck finish.

  • Patent number: 4353475
    Abstract: The invention contemplates safety-closure structure involving threaded engagement of cap and bottle-neck members, wherein coacting lug formations on the respective members have compliantly yieldable cammed latching engagement in approach to a fully-closed relation of the members and wherein, once in the fully-closed relation, a positive-lock relation prevents unthreading rotation of the members. The engaged threads are sized for a quantum of axial lost-motion, and resilient action of a seal which reacts axially between the members is operative to constantly load the cap member to its axially upper limit of the lost motion. The lug formations are of such axially limited extent that, when the members are in their fully-closed relation, an axial depression of the cap member through the lost motion and against the resilient seal action is necessary to free the positive-lock relation of the lugs formations, thus then permitting a thread-off rotary manipulation of the cap member.

  • Patent number: 4299372
    Abstract: The invention contemplates a sprue-gate configuration embodied in one of the cavity-defining parts of a multiple-part mold for injection molding of plastic articles. At the gate region of sprue discharge into the cavity, the sprue converges into communication with a cluster of restricted-gate orifices which are in closely spaced, angularly distributed relation about the generally central axis of the sprue. The combined area of the restricted-gate orifices may be less than the area of a conventional single-orifice gate serving a cavity of the same size.
